Our Tour Guide warned us that the back of a locomotive shop isn't that pretty. This is the Huck's former Quincy and Torcjh Lake 2-6-0 #3.It was purchased in the 1970s to be rebuilt as back up for number 2, but when 464 came into the scene, they just dumped it back here behind the shops. Plans call for the locomotive to someday be reassembled and cosmetically restored for display.
